We are looking for Kitchen Porters to join our passionate Kitchen team in both our Thyme Restaurant – The Ox Barn, and our award-winning Village Pub – The Swan.
Rooted in a passion for the local land, food and entertaining, our carefully curated menus tell a story of the farm and seasons. Under the direction of Charlie Hibbert, the chefs and gardeners at Thyme work together to select and grow the fruits, vegetables and herbs used to create his modern British countryside fare.
A sustainable ethos and a dedication to good, honest food served without pretention is at the heart of our kitchen. Our menus change daily in response to the produce in our two acre kitchen garden, in addition to using fresh eggs from our flocks of hens, geese, quail and ducks and lamb, hogget and mutton from their rare-breed sheep.
The Ox Barn is a contemporary restaurant with a spectacular bar and seven-and-a-half metre Charvet open kitchen.
Just a short stroll from Thyme, The Swan sits at the heart of the village of Southrop adjacent to the green. Its recorded history dates back as far as 1606 when it was known as the Bakehouse, serving bread and ale to the farm workers.
Responsibilities
· To ensure the kitchen areas are kept clean and tidy
· Supporting the chefs during service, cleaning and returning essential cooking equipment
· Working with the FOH team to ensure a quick and clean turnaround of washing up
· Taking responsibility for emptying bins and recycling, including looking after the main bin area
· Cleaning down after service and ensuring all surfaces and floors are spotless
· Making sure outside areas are clean, tidy and swept, free of cigarettes and rubbish and perfect for guests
· Assisting chefs with basic prep as needed
